體檢套餐的“樂高式”變革:智能系統如何重塑健康管理

  在醫療信息化浪潮中,體檢套餐配置正經歷一場靜默的革命。傳統體檢中心如同堆積木般將檢查項目簡單組合的模式,正在被智能系統重構為精準匹配個體需求的動態拼圖。這場變革的核心,在于構建一個能像樂高積木般自由組合、像智能導航般精準推薦的體檢套餐配置體系。

  In the wave of medical informatization, the configuration of physical examination packages is undergoing a silent revolution. The traditional physical examination center, which simply combines examination items like stacked wood, is being reconstructed by intelligent systems into a dynamic puzzle that accurately matches individual needs. The core of this transformation lies in building a medical examination package configuration system that can be freely combined like Lego blocks and accurately recommended like intelligent navigation.

  一、解構與重組:體檢項目的模塊化革命

  1、 Deconstruction and Restructuring: The Modular Revolution of Physical Examination Projects

  現代體檢管理系統首先打破傳統套餐的固定框架,將每個檢查項目轉化為可獨立調用的數字模塊。這些模塊包含著多維度的元數據標簽:從基礎的生命體征檢測到專項的腫瘤標志物篩查,從適合青壯年的運動功能評估到專為中老年設計的骨密度檢測,每個項目都被賦予精準的適用人群畫像和醫學價值權重。

  The modern physical examination management system first breaks the fixed framework of traditional packages and converts each examination item into a digital module that can be independently called. These modules contain multidimensional metadata labels: from basic vital sign detection to specialized tumor marker screening, from motor function assessment suitable for young adults to bone density testing designed specifically for middle-aged and elderly people, each item is assigned precise applicable population profiles and medical value weights.

  這種解構帶來前所未有的靈活性。系統支持三級組合模式:基礎層是經過醫學驗證的標準化項目庫,中間層是可配置的疾病風險篩查包,頂層則是完全個性化的自由組合區。就像搭建積木城堡,既能用預設模板快速構建,也能根據地形特點自由創作。某三甲醫院的實踐數據顯示,模塊化配置使套餐更新周期從季度縮短至周級,項目調整響應速度提升80%。

  This deconstruction brings unprecedented flexibility. The system supports a three-level combination mode: the basic layer is a standardized project library that has been medically validated, the middle layer is a configurable disease risk screening package, and the top layer is a fully personalized free combination area. Just like building a brick castle, it can be quickly constructed using preset templates and freely created according to the characteristics of the terrain. Practical data from a tertiary hospital shows that modular configuration has shortened the package update cycle from quarterly to weekly, and increased project adjustment response speed by 80%.

  二、智能決策引擎:從經驗配置到數據驅動

  2、 Intelligent Decision Engine: From Experience Configuration to Data Driven

  在模塊化架構基礎上,智能推薦算法成為套餐配置的“隱形醫生”。系統通過三個維度構建決策模型:首先是基于循證醫學的疾病風險評估,整合年齡、性別、家族史等20余項風險因子;其次是設備資源動態調配,實時分析各檢查科室的承載能力;最后是用戶體驗優化,自動平衡檢查時長與流程舒適度。

  On the basis of modular architecture, intelligent recommendation algorithms become the "invisible doctors" for package configuration. The system constructs a decision model through three dimensions: firstly, based on evidence-based medicine disease risk assessment, integrating more than 20 risk factors such as age, gender, and family history; Secondly, dynamic allocation of equipment resources and real-time analysis of the carrying capacity of each inspection department; Finally, there is user experience optimization, which automatically balances the inspection time and process comfort.

  這種智能配置不是簡單的數據堆砌,而是模擬臨床思維的決策過程。當系統為一位45歲企業高管生成套餐時,會綜合考慮其久坐辦公特征(增加頸動脈超聲)、高管職業壓力(納入心理評估量表)、以及體檢時間窗口(優化空腹項目順序)。某健康管理中心的應用表明,智能推薦套餐的依從性比傳統套餐提升35%,重點疾病檢出率提高22%。

  This intelligent configuration is not simply data stacking, but simulating the decision-making process of clinical thinking. When the system generates a package for a 45 year old corporate executive, it takes into account their sedentary office characteristics (increased carotid ultrasound), executive occupational stress (included in psychological assessment scales), and physical examination time window (optimized fasting item sequence). The application of a certain health management center shows that the compliance of intelligent recommendation packages has increased by 35% compared to traditional packages, and the detection rate of key diseases has increased by 22%.

  三、動態適配機制:打造會進化的健康方案

  3、 Dynamic adaptation mechanism: creating evolving health solutions

  優秀的體檢套餐配置系統應具備自我進化能力。通過建立雙循環學習機制:在微觀層面,每個體檢者的選擇數據都會反向優化推薦算法;在宏觀層面,區域性疾病譜變化會觸發套餐庫的自動更新。這種動態適配機制,使體檢方案始終與醫學發展保持同頻共振。

  An excellent medical examination package configuration system should have the ability to self evolve. By establishing a dual loop learning mechanism: at the micro level, the selection data of each examinee will be optimized in reverse for the recommendation algorithm; At the macro level, regional changes in the disease spectrum will trigger automatic updates to the package library. This dynamic adaptation mechanism keeps the physical examination plan in resonance with medical development at the same frequency.

  權限管理體系為這種靈活性筑牢安全邊界。系統設置三級配置權限:醫學專家掌控核心算法參數,科室主任管理專科套餐模板,前臺人員僅能調用已審核的組合方案。這種設計既保證配置效率,又避免出現醫學邏輯錯誤。某區域醫聯體的實踐證明,分級管控使套餐配置差錯率下降至0.03%以下。

  The permission management system establishes a secure boundary for this flexibility. The system sets up three levels of configuration permissions: medical experts control core algorithm parameters, department heads manage specialty package templates, and front-end personnel can only access approved combination schemes. This design ensures configuration efficiency while avoiding medical logic errors. The practice of a medical consortium in a certain region has proven that hierarchical control reduces the error rate of package configuration to below 0.03%.

  這場靜默的變革正在重塑健康管理的底層邏輯。當體檢套餐從固定套餐進化為智能生長的健康方案,醫療機構得以在標準化與個性化之間找到完美支點。未來的體檢中心,將不再是簡單的檢查項目集合地,而是精準健康管理的策源地,每個體檢者都能獲得量身定制的健康導航圖,這正是醫療信息化最動人的價值呈現。

  This silent transformation is reshaping the underlying logic of health management. When the physical examination package evolves from a fixed package to an intelligent growth health plan, medical institutions can find the perfect pivot between standardization and personalization. The future medical examination center will no longer be a simple gathering place for examination items, but a source of precise health management. Each examinee can obtain a customized health navigation map, which is the most touching value presentation of medical informatization.
